Transaction 753342aaa97df4d8a5f9674bbd31ec00de509a436a094bc178b691c610b7a29b
1 Input
1 Output
-
753342aaa97df4d8a5f9674bbd31ec00de509a436a094bc178b691c610b7a29b:0
- value
- 782943
- script pubkey
- OP_0 OP_PUSHBYTES_20 f45c104456f58b6b8e6a4f8b59aa0bcf53213609
- address
- bc1q73wpq3zk7k9khrn2f794n2steafjzdsfya3f5l